B26FA CRANKING REQUEST CIRCUIT
DTC Logic
DTC DETECTION LOGIC
NOTE:
- DTC B26FA can be detected even though the related circuit is not used in this vehicle.
- If DTC B26FA is displayed with DTC U1000, first perform the trouble diagnosis for DTC U1000. Refer to
"DTC Logic" Body Control System.
- If DTC B26FA is displayed with DTC U1010, first perform the trouble diagnosis for DTC U1010. Refer to
"DTC Logic" Body Control System.
DTC CONFIRMATION PROCEDURE
1. PERFORM DTC CONFIRMATION
1.Start engine and wait 2 seconds or more at idle speed.
2.Drive vehicle for 2 seconds or more.
3.Check DTC in "Self Diagnostic Result" mode of "BCM" using CONSULT.
Is DTC detected?
YES- Go to "Diagnosis Procedure" .
NO- INSPECTION END
Diagnosis Procedure
1. CHECK CRANKING REQUEST SIGNAL
1.Turn ignition switch ON.
2.Check voltage between BCM harness connector and ground under the following conditions.
Is the inspection result normal?
YES- GO TO 3.
NO- GO TO 2.
2. CHECK CRANKING REQUEST SIGNAL CIRCUIT
1.Turn ignition switch OFF.
2.Disconnect BCM connector.
3.Disconnect ECM connector.
4.Check continuity between BCM harness connector and ECM harness connector.
5.Check continuity between BCM harness connector and ground.
Is the inspection result normal?
YES- GO TO 3.
NO- Repair or replace harness.
3. REPLACE BCM
1.Replace BCM. Refer to "Removal and Installation" Service and Repair.
2.Perform initialization of BCM and registration of all Intelligent Keys using CONSULT.
3.Perform DTC CONFIRMATION PROCEDURE for DTC B26FA. Refer to "DTC Logic" .
Is DTC detected?
YES- GO TO 4.
NO- INSPECTION END
4. REPLACE ECM
1.Replace ECM. Refer to "Removal and Installation" For USA and Canada.
2.Perform "ADDITIONAL SERVICE WHEN REPLACING ECM". Refer to "Work Procedure" For USA and Canada.
- INSPECTION END
